Output 8e4a51aa0183fa3e0c8cf6cdff1e453b71b3e41eae4138d8170db84fbc7f68ed:0

value
4137633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aabbc2f8b6e38c09960c188d307903739c35541a OP_EQUAL
address
3HFmj4SXjHUxGVxJnzMsMJe7wyH4zijKfG
transaction
8e4a51aa0183fa3e0c8cf6cdff1e453b71b3e41eae4138d8170db84fbc7f68ed
spent
true